Ottieni il percorso corrente per lo script in AppleScript e aggiungi sottodirectory

4

Ho un AppleScript che mi piacerebbe poter usare da qualsiasi parte del file system. Attualmente, ha alcuni percorsi che sono hardcoded, quindi viene eseguito solo dalla cartella Download. Come devo fare per ottenere il percorso corrente per AppleScript e quindi aggiungere una sottodirectory a quel percorso una volta ottenuto?

Impostare il percorso corrente per lo script come una variabile sarebbe preferibile (forse current_path).

    
posta Zyniker 28.10.2013 - 01:39
fonte

1 risposta

8

Puoi ottenere il percorso dello script corrente con path to me . Estrarre il percorso della directory che contiene lo script è leggermente complicato:

tell application "Finder"
    set current_path to container of (path to me) as alias
end tell
    
risposta data 28.10.2013 - 06:38
fonte

Leggi altre domande sui tag